How to Buy a Mitsubishi Montero Sport in the UAE: 6 Steps

  1. 🔍 Research GCC Spec Listings

    Focus your search on GCC spec Mitsubishi Montero Sport models, as these are built for UAE heat and sand. Avoid US imports, which often lack proper cooling and fetch lower resale values in Dubai and Abu Dhabi.

  2. 🛠️ Book a Pre-Purchase Inspection

    Schedule a full inspection at a reputable workshop like Al Futtaim Service Centre or AAA Service Center in Al Quoz. Montero Sports can hide suspension wear from off-road use, so a lift inspection is essential.

  3. 📜 Check Service History and Warranty

    Ask for stamped service records, ideally from Al Habtoor Motors, the official Mitsubishi dealer. Confirm if any agency warranty remains, as this adds value and peace of mind.

  4. 🧾 Verify Mulkiya and Fines

    Request the current Mulkiya (registration card) and check for outstanding RTA fines or Salik dues. Unpaid fines can block the transfer process at Tasjeel.

  5. 🏢 Complete RTA Testing and Insurance

    Take the car for RTA testing at Tasjeel or Shamil. Arrange comprehensive insurance—companies like Oman Insurance and AXA offer competitive rates for the Montero Sport.

  6. 🔑 Transfer Ownership

    Both buyer and seller must be present at the RTA or Tasjeel with Emirates IDs. Once the transfer is complete, you’ll receive the new Mulkiya in your name and can drive away legally.

Mitsubishi Montero Sport Mechanical Inspection Checklist

  • Check the air conditioning for rapid cooling—weak AC is a red flag in the UAE climate and expensive to repair.
  • Inspect the radiator and cooling system for leaks or corrosion, as overheating is a known issue if coolant isn’t maintained with GCC spec fluids.
  • Listen for clunks from the front suspension; bushings and ball joints wear quickly after off-road use in the desert.
  • Test the 4WD system, including low range and Super Select modes, as some owners rarely use them and actuators can seize.
  • Look for oil leaks around the engine and transmission—older Montero Sports sometimes develop rear main seal leaks in high heat.
  • Check the timing belt service history; GCC models require replacement every 90,000 km, and skipping this can lead to engine failure.
  • Inspect the underbody for rust or sand damage, especially if the car has been used for dune bashing near Al Ain or Liwa.
  • Test the brakes for vibration or squealing; warped discs are common after repeated heavy braking on Sheikh Zayed Road.
  • Listen for whining from the rear differential—some 2017-2019 models had premature bearing wear in UAE conditions.
  • Scan for warning lights on the dashboard, especially ABS and traction control, as sensor failures are not uncommon in dusty environments.
  • Check the power steering for stiffness or noise; fluid leaks can occur due to high temperatures and sand ingress.
  • Review the battery age and condition—UAE heat shortens battery life, and a weak battery can cause starting issues.

Mitsubishi Montero Sport Body and Interior Checklist

  • Inspect the dashboard and door panels for sun damage or cracking—prolonged exposure to Dubai sun can cause fading and warping.
  • Check the roof lining for sagging, especially in older models; high humidity in Sharjah and Ajman accelerates this issue.
  • Look for peeling or bubbling paint on the roof and bonnet, a common problem if the car was parked outdoors without shade.
  • Test all power windows and mirrors, as sand can jam the mechanisms over time.
  • Examine the leather or fabric seats for wear, tears, or discoloration—sweat and dust take a toll in UAE summers.
  • Check for water stains or musty smells in the cabin, which may indicate previous flood damage from heavy rains in Fujairah or Ras Al Khaimah.
  • Inspect the headlights and taillights for yellowing or fogging, as UV exposure is intense in the Emirates.
  • Test the infotainment system and Bluetooth connectivity; some GCC models had early software bugs that required dealer updates.
  • Look for cracked or chipped windshields—gravel from desert roads and highways is a frequent culprit.
  • Check the rear AC vents for airflow, as rear cooling is essential for family use in UAE heat.
  • Inspect the spare tyre and jack; off-roaders often neglect these after desert trips.
  • Review the door seals for dust ingress, especially if the car was used in sandy areas around Al Marmoom or Al Qudra.

Documents Required to Buy a Used Mitsubishi Montero Sport in the UAE

Document Provider Required Notes
Mulkiya (Registration Card) Seller Yes Must be valid and match chassis number; RTA will not process transfer without it.
Emirates ID Buyer & Seller Yes Original Emirates ID required at Tasjeel for both parties; copies not accepted.
Valid Insurance Certificate Buyer Yes Comprehensive insurance is recommended for Montero Sport; required before transfer.
RTA Vehicle Test Certificate RTA/Tasjeel Yes Must be issued within 30 days; required for all used car transfers in Dubai and Abu Dhabi.
Service History Seller/Dealer No Not mandatory but highly recommended; agency stamps from Al Habtoor Motors add value.
Outstanding Fines Clearance Seller Yes All RTA and Salik fines must be cleared before transfer; check online or at Tasjeel.
Bank Clearance Letter (if financed) Seller's Bank If applicable Required if the Montero Sport has an active loan; no transfer without bank NOC.

Mitsubishi Montero Sport Red Flags: What to Watch Out For

  • ⚠️ Non-GCC Spec Imports

    US or Japanese imports lack proper cooling and fetch much lower resale value in the UAE.

  • ⚠️ Overheating History

    Repeated overheating can warp the cylinder head; check for coolant stains or recent radiator work.

  • ⚠️ Flood Damage

    Musty smells or electrical gremlins may indicate flood exposure, especially after Sharjah or Fujairah storms.

  • ⚠️ Unusual 4WD Noises

    Grinding or delayed engagement in 4WD modes often means expensive transfer case repairs.

  • ⚠️ Missing Service Records

    Lack of agency or specialist service history is a major risk for timing belt and transmission issues.

  • ⚠️ Paint Mismatch or Overspray

    Panels with mismatched paint may hide accident repairs; check for RTA accident history online.

  • ⚠️ Dashboard Warning Lights

    Persistent ABS or engine lights can signal costly sensor or ECU faults, common after sand ingress.

  • ⚠️ Excessive Suspension Wear

    Clunks or uneven tyre wear suggest hard off-road use, especially in models used for desert safaris.

Mitsubishi Montero Sport Ownership Costs in the UAE

  • Annual comprehensive insurance for a 2021 Montero Sport in Dubai typically ranges from AED 1,800 to AED 2,400.
  • Routine servicing at Al Habtoor Motors costs around AED 900–1,200 per visit, with major services every 40,000 km.
  • Spare parts are widely available and affordable compared to Toyota Fortuner or Ford Everest rivals.
  • Fuel costs are moderate for the class, but expect higher consumption if you do frequent off-roading in Al Qudra.
  • Tyres last 40,000–50,000 km in normal use; desert driving shortens lifespan due to sand abrasion.

Mitsubishi Montero Sport Resale Value in the UAE

  • GCC spec Montero Sports hold value better than US imports, especially in Dubai and Abu Dhabi.
  • Depreciation is moderate—expect a 3-year-old model to retain about 60% of its original price in the UAE market.
  • White and silver colours are most in demand for resale, as they handle the UAE sun best and appeal to fleet buyers.
  • Agency service history from Al Habtoor Motors boosts resale price by AED 3,000–5,000 over non-agency serviced cars.
  • Used Mitsubishi Montero Sport Dubai listings move quickly if the car is GCC spec and accident-free.
